The greatest possible value for the width is 8 centimeters.
If the width of rectangle is w and given that the length of a rectangle is five times its width.
Then, the length of rectangle [tex]=5w[/tex]
Perimeter of rectangle is,
[tex]Perimerer=2(length+width)\\\\Perimeter=2(5w+w)=12w[/tex]
Since, if the perimeter is at most 96 centimeters.
the greatest possible value for the width is,
[tex]12w\leq 96\\\\w\leq \frac{96}{12}\\ \\w\leq 8[/tex]
